Crockpot Zuppa Toscana Recipe-Olive Garden Copycat

One of my favorite Olive Garden dishes, this crockpot Zuppa Toscana recipe can be made in your own kitchen! Bring Italy home with this easy, delicious soup! It's a simple, hearty dish that is great for those busy evenings!
Course Soup
Cuisine Italian
Prep Time 20 minutes
Cook Time 4 hours
Total Time 4 hours 20 minutes
Servings 6 -8

Ingredients

  • 1 lb. ground Italian sausage I use mild
  • 6-8 russet potatoes
  • 1 Tbsp minced garlic
  • 4 cups 32oz chicken broth
  • 1 medium onion chopped
  • 1 bunch kale stems removed and chopped
  • 1 cup heavy whipping cream
  • Salt & pepper to taste
  • Water see instructions
  • Parmesan or Colby Jack cheese

Instructions

  • In a skillet, crumble and brown Italian sausage, about 6-8 minutes.
  • Add onion and garlic and cook for an additional 2-3 minutes.
  • Peel and dice potatoes.
  • In a 5 qt. (or larger) crockpot, add sausage and potatoes.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
  • Pour chicken broth on top of potatoes/sausage. Make sure potatoes are covered and stir.
  • Put lid on and cook on LOW 5-6 hours or HIGH 3-4 hours.
  • Remove lid and add kale and heavy whipping cream. Stir.
  • Cover and cook for an additional 30 minutes on high.
  • Serve immediately and garnish with cheese.
